Get started7a The Mews is an end-of-terrace house in Southampton (SO19 0HN). It has a recorded floor area of 86 m² (around 926 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2012 onwards and council tax band B. The latest certificate (March 2024) shows a C (score 79), near the top of the C band. Earlier certificates rated it B (October 2013);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, roof ef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and window ef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 90).
At 86 m² the property is well over the postcode median (58 m² across 39 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ock.
7a The Mews has no Land Registry sales on file,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ands since registration began.
